Launching Helldivers 2 only to be met with an unresponsive black screen can be an incredibly frustrating experience for players eager to jump into action. This startup glitch typically occurs before the main menu loads, leaving the game frozen without any audio or display output. Fortunately, several community-tested troubleshooting methods can resolve this launch issue and get your game running smoothly again.

Resetting Game Configuration Settings

One of the most common causes of the startup black screen is a corrupted user settings file or conflicts with display resolution settings. Gamers can resolve this by navigating to the AppData folder on their PC and deleting or renaming the user configuration file. When you launch the game again, Helldivers 2 automatically generates a fresh file with default settings.

Alternatively, players can manually edit the configuration file to disable fullscreen mode on boot. Changing the fullscreen parameter to false forces the application to load in borderless windowed mode, effectively bypassing display handshake failures.

Adjusting Steam Launch Options and Privileges

Running the game executable with elevated permissions can prevent startup crashes caused by administrative restrictions. Right-clicking the main executable file, selecting properties, and checking the option to run as an administrator often resolves access issues. Additionally, setting compatibility mode to Windows 8 has proven helpful for many PC users.

Modifying Steam startup parameters offers another reliable solution for stubborn launch errors. Adding specific launch commands like -dx11 forces the title to render via DirectX 11, which stabilizes initialization for older graphics configurations. Disabling Steam Input in the game's controller properties can also prevent controller conflicts that trigger black screens.

Verifying Files and Driver Compatibility

Missing or damaged installation files frequently cause software to freeze immediately upon execution. Utilizing Steam's built-in file verification tool scans the game directory and automatically replaces missing or corrupted data. This simple maintenance step ensures your installation remains intact after major updates.

Outdated graphics drivers or missing system libraries can also lead to persistent startup failures. Updating your GPU drivers to the latest software version guarantees optimal compatibility with recent patches. Installing the latest Visual C++ Redistributable packages provides essential system DLLs required for a successful startup sequence.
